Fair Isle Beanie Pattern
Stay warm and stylish with this Fair Isle beanie pattern. Perfect for the winter season!
Materials:
- Yarn: Worsted weight yarn (4 ply)
- Color A (Main color): 1 skein in Imperial Purple
- Color B (Contrast color): 1 skein in Arctic White
- Needles: US 7 / UK 7 / 4.5mm double-pointed needles
- Tapestry needle
- Stitch marker
Gauge:
20 stitches x 24 rows = 4 inches in stockinette stitch
Instructions:
- Using Color A, cast on 90 stitches. Join in the round, being careful not to twist stitches. Place marker at beginning of round.
- Rounds 1-10: *K2, P2* repeat across round.
- Switch to Color B.
- Rounds 11-14: Knit all stitches with Color B.
- Begin Fair Isle pattern:
- Rounds 15-30: Follow Fair Isle chart, alternating colors every 2 stitches.
- Continue in stockinette stitch with Color A until the hat measures 7 inches from cast-on edge.
- Shape crown:
- Round 1: *K8, K2tog* repeat across round.
- Round 2: Knit all stitches.
- Round 3: *K7, K2tog* repeat across round.
- Rounds 4-5: Knit all stitches.
- Continue decreasing in this manner until 9 stitches remain.
- Break yarn, leaving a long tail. Thread tail through remaining stitches, pull tight to close the top of the hat.
- Weave in all ends and block the hat to shape.
